Autumn Harvest Trail Weekend
SOB PAŹ 10
Autumn Harvest Trail Weekend is a two-day trail running series at Lake Bastrop in the Lost Pines area of Central Texas, held in the fall. The weekend offers a range of events from short trail races to long endurance efforts, with options including a 5K, 5-miler, 10K, 10-miler, 20-miler, half marathon, marathon, 50K, and a Last Standing ultra. Saturday is the Ultra & Distance Day, featuring the longest events designed for runners seeking hours on dirt trails. The courses traverse fast dirt trails alongside Lake Bastrop, featuring winding lakeside sections, open skies, and tall pines. The most unique event is the Last Standing ultra: participants begin at Basecamp on the Gideon Loop and complete a 4.17-mile loop each hour. This format can extend to 24 loops, approximately 100 miles, with a 50-runner limit and a cumulative-time tiebreaker if necessary. The 9:00 AM start time means runners will face the heat of the day, sunset around the tenth hour, a full night, and potentially into the next morning if they meet the hourly cutoff.

Inks Lake Trail Run/Ruck
SOB PAŹ 17
The Inks Lake Trail Run/Ruck is an off-road event held in mid-October at 3630 Park Road 4 West in Burnet, Texas. The event utilizes local park trails, offering participants multiple distances on dirt: 50K, marathon, half marathon, 10K, 5K, a half-marathon ruck, and a 1-mile youth trail run for children 12 and under. The event is designed to accommodate various trail participants, not just a single group. Ultra runners, marathoners, shorter-distance runners, ruckers carrying weight, and young children each have separate starts, with staggered start times based on distance. All participants receive event merchandise, though the deadline for guaranteed shirts is before race day, meaning late registrants may not receive one.
Spooky Sprint-Austin
SOB PAŹ 17
Spooky Sprint-Austin is a Halloween-themed running event in Austin, held in October. It offers a half marathon, 10K, 5K, 1 mile, kids dash, virtual race, and a volunteer-then-run entry. The event is designed for families and casual groups alongside competitive runners: the 5K, 10K, and half marathon are chip-timed with live results and awards, while the 1 mile and kids dash are untimed. The event provides finishers with race swag, including custom bibs, designer shirts, and medals for the main distances. The kids dash includes a mini bib, youth shirt, and a child-specific medal. Children 10 and under can participate in the kids dash for free if they forgo the swag. The 5K and 10K also have reduced pricing for participants 12 and under. Finish-line treats, free participant photos, and a virtual option contribute to the race's playful atmosphere, even for timed runners who receive results and awards.

Mujeres and Marigolds
SOB PAŹ 24
Mujeres & Marigolds is a women-only trail race held at Rocky Hill Ranch in Smithville, Texas. It offers 100k, 50k, 25k, 10k, and 5k individual distances, along with a 100k relay option. This event has a limited field size, capped at 500 participants. The race begins early, with participants in the longest distances starting first, followed by shorter distances throughout the morning. The course features rolling ranch trails with modest climbs, requiring runners to adjust their pace frequently rather than maintaining a steady rhythm like on flat roads. The 100k race consists of four loops, the 50k of two loops, and the 25k, 10k, and 5k each involve a single loop. The event is designed for both individuals new to trail running and seasoned runners seeking an extended run on unpaved terrain without a large gathering.
Fields of Gold 50K • Marathon • Half Marathon • 12 Hour • 1 Hour • 10K • 5K
SOB PAŹ 24
Fields of Gold Trail Run takes place in the fall at Shaffer Bend Recreation Area in Marble Falls, Texas, within the Texas Hill Country. The series offers runners a wide selection of distances: 50K, marathon, half marathon, a 12-hour endurance challenge, a 1-hour Gold Hour challenge, 10K, and 5K. The course is designed with dirt and park terrain, featuring rolling hills, meadow trails, lakeside paths, golden grasslands, wooded valleys, and overlooks across the bend area. The longer races cover the most varied terrain. The half marathon is presented as challenging yet accessible for runners not aiming for an ultra distance. The 12-hour event focuses on total miles accumulated rather than a set finish time, with aid stations and support available throughout the day. The 1-hour race applies the same endurance concept in a condensed format. The 5K Harvest Fun Run serves as the family-friendly option, winding through the meadows. The event also supports HKRS Cedar Park Youth Running Programs, connecting race day activities with local youth running initiatives.
Lost Souls Trail Run
NIE PAŹ 25
Lost Souls Trail Run is a fall trail race at Rocky Hill Ranch in Smithville, Texas, offering 50k, 25k, 10k, and 5k distances. The 50k begins first and covers two loops, while the 25k, 10k, and 5k each use a single loop. The event is limited to 500 participants, maintaining a more intimate scale compared to large city races. The course features short ascents and considerable rolling terrain, requiring runners to adjust their effort frequently rather than maintaining a steady pace. It is designed to accommodate both novice trail runners and seasoned athletes, with shorter races for those new to the sport and an ultra option for a more demanding run. Participants receive medals and merchandise, and the event includes complimentary camping, with showers and restrooms available at the ranch.

O biegach 10K w Austin

Notatki z treningów w Austin

Austin organizuje 48 biegów 10K w 2026 w promieniu 80 km od centrum miasta — nadchodzące daty, cykliczne serie i inne biegi w okolicy, wszystko w jednym miejscu.

U nas na base miles najczęściej pomykamy po Ann and Roy Butler Hike-and-Bike Trail, bo to 10-milowa pętla dookoła Lady Bird Lake. Na Town Lake masz widoki na miasto, wodę, trochę szutru, beton, fontanny, łazienki i łatwo sobie wybierzesz dystans. Dla trailowców Barton Creek Greenbelt to ponad 12 mil wapiennych ścieżek, podbiegów i miejscówek do pływania po deszczu. A dla tych od asfaltu, Southern Walnut Creek Trail to 7 mil równej nawierzchni przez zacienione lasy. Żeby nie było nudno w tygodniu, są The Loop Running Supply, Morning Jo’s, East Side Beer Runners, Speedshop Mafia i Austin Front Runners. Główne imprezy w kalendarzu to Austin Marathon & Half Marathon, Cap10K i Spurs Austin International Half Marathon.

Na rowerze jeździmy tu po wszystkim – od Z2 na Austin Sunday Loop po singletracki pod wapiennymi klifami Barton Creek Greenbelt. Podjazd ma 6 km i 422 m przewyższenia, więc spokojnie zrobisz interwały, nie wyjeżdżając z miasta. Pętla ma 9 mil i 14,070 ft podjazdów, jak jedziesz zgodnie ze wskazówkami zegara. Prawdziwe wyzwanie to Zachodni Austin z Hill of Life, Mount Bonnell i Devil’s Backbone. Na gravelu w Walnut Creek Park jest lżej, a Pedernales River i Rocky Creek Ranch to już wyższa szkoła jazdy. Jak chcesz pojeździć w grupie, są Violet Crown Cycling, Breakfast Club i Social Cycling Austin, a główne imprezy to GASP i Livestrong Classic.

Jesień to w Austin najlepszy czas na treningi, wtedy miejscowi zaczynają kręcić większe objętości. Latem biegacze i rowerzyści muszą ruszać wcześnie albo późno, szukać cienia i nie szarżować z wysiłkiem. W upały fajnie sprawdzają się nocne jazdy, tylko trzeba mieć dobre światła. Lady Bird Lake i Southern Walnut Creek Trail są spoko na łatwe Z2, kiedy słońce jeszcze mocno grzeje. Barton Creek Greenbelt zapewnia biegaczom i MTB-owcom cień, kamienie i przyjemny chłód po deszczu. Zima nie zwalnia tempa w mieście, a Barton Springs Pool ma 68 stopni przez cały rok, idealnie dla triathlonistów.
